51
Dev开发社区
首页
文章
问答
工具
搜索
登录
注册
#redis
Redis 分布式锁
一套系统,集群部署,高并发时,访问同一个业务方法,该业务涉及到数据的安全性、准确性,只允许单线程操作,这个时候就需要分布式锁来实现。 redis实现分布式锁可以采用ValueOperations.setIfAbsent(key,value)或RedisConnection.setNX(key,value)方法 ...
代码星球
·
2021-02-12
Redis
分布式
Linux centos7 redis安装教程
1.下载解压 #下载至/home/install(或windows系统下载后上传) mkdir/home/install cd/home/install wget http://124.205.69.171/files/6160000006F201F1/download.redis.io/releas...
代码星球
·
2021-02-12
Linux
centos7
redis
安装
教程
SpringBoot整合Redis集群
Redis集群环境搭建:https://www.cnblogs.com/zwcry/p/9174233.html1.pom.xml<projectxmlns="http://maven.apache.org/POM/4.0.0"xmlns:xsi="http://www.w3.org/2001/XMLSche...
代码星球
·
2021-02-12
SpringBoot
整合
Redis
集群
Redis集群环境搭建
注意:5.0版本后集群搭建有所改变,不在使用ruby语言创建集群,所以可以跨过ruby的相关插件安装描述:本章节主要单服务器搭建集群,在一个服务器上启动多个不同端口的redis服务,非真实环境。 真实环境下redis集群会搭建在多个物理服务器上,并非单一的服务器,但搭建方式一样。 安装教程:https://www...
代码星球
·
2021-02-12
Redis
集群
环境
搭建
SpringBoot整合redis哨兵主从服务
前提环境: 主从配置 http://www.cnblogs.com/zwcry/p/9046207.html 哨兵配置 https://www.cnblogs.com/zwcry/p/9134721.html1.配置pom.xml<projectxmlns="http://maven.apache.org...
代码星球
·
2021-02-12
SpringBoot
整合
redis
哨兵
主从
redis发布订阅
Redis发布订阅(publish/subscribe)是一种消息通信模式:发送者(pub)发送消息,订阅者(sub)接收消息。1.订阅者 SUBSCRIBE订阅 redisChat 订阅频道 2.发布者 PUBLISH 发布 redisChat 发布频道 参考:菜鸟教程http://ww...
代码星球
·
2021-02-12
redis
发布
订阅
Redis 五数据类型
五中数据类型:String、List、Set、Hash、zset(sortedset)Rediskey的数量最大上限为512MB,(建议最大数量不要超过五百万,过百万后就应该根据分类属性,进行微服务和缓存的拆分)Redisvalue的对象最大上限为512MB,(除硬性需求,不建议保存M级及以上数据)链接指令:./src...
代码星球
·
2021-02-12
Redis
数据
类型
redis 主从同步搭建
安装教程:https://www.cnblogs.com/zwcry/p/9505949.html 1)创建主从目录 mkdir /usr/local/redis-ms cd/usr/local/redis-ms/ mkdir6381 mkdir6382 mkdir6382...
代码星球
·
2021-02-12
redis
主从
同步
搭建
SpringBoot Redis工具类封装
packagecom.sze.redis.util;importjava.util.List;importjava.util.Set;importjava.util.concurrent.TimeUnit;/****<br>类名:RedisCachesManager*<br>描述:缓存管理类*&...
代码星球
·
2021-02-12
SpringBoot
Redis
工具
封装
Spring session共享(使用redis)
前提:需要使用redis做session存储一、效果演练(这里使用SpringBoot工程,Spring同理) 1.一个工程使用两个端口启用,或者两个工程两个端口启用(这里使用一个工程两个端口号启动) (1)#设置properties配置的服务器端口号 server.port=8081 然后...
代码星球
·
2021-02-12
Spring
session
共享
使用
redis
SpringBoot学习笔记(13)----使用Spring Session+redis实现一个简单的集群
session集群的解决方案:1.扩展指定server利用Servlet容器提供的插件功能,自定义HttpSession的创建和管理策略,并通过配置的方式替换掉默认的策略。缺点:耦合Tomcat/Jetty等Servlet容器,不能随意更换容器。2.利用Filter利用HttpServletRequestWrapper...
代码星球
·
2021-02-12
SpringBoot
学习
笔记
----
使用
Redis安装配置与Jedis访问数据库
NoSQL(NoSQL=NotOnlySQL),意即“不仅仅是SQL”,泛指非关系型的数据库。NoSQL数据库的四大分类键值(Key-Value)存储数据库这一类数据库主要会使用到一个哈希表,这个表中有一个特定的键和一个指针指向特定的数据。Key/value模型对于IT系统来说的优势在于简单、易部署。但是如果DBA只对...
代码星球
·
2021-02-12
Redis
安装
配置
Jedis
访问
springboot Cacheable(redis),解决key乱码问题
importorg.springframework.context.annotation.Bean;importorg.springframework.data.redis.core.RedisTemplate;importorg.springframework.data.redis.serializer.Generi...
代码星球
·
2021-02-11
springboot
Cacheable
redis
解决
key
docker-compose 安装redis sentinel,共享主机网络模式
采坑记录:dockersentinel模式安装完后因为是使用bridge模式,所以只有docker中运行的程序才能访问。刚开始尝试使用端口映射,返现sentinel返回的地址依然是docker的内网地址。docker-compose.ymlversion:'3.2'services:master:container_n...
代码星球
·
2021-02-11
docker-compose
安装
redis
sentinel
共享
redis 4.x 安装哨兵模式 sentinel
1、下载http://download.redis.io/releases/redis-4.0.11.tar.gz2、解压tarzxvf redis-4.0.11.tar.gz3、安装cd redis-4.0.11makemakeinstall4、修改配置文件4.1拷贝redis.conf ...
代码星球
·
2021-02-11
redis
4.x
安装
哨兵
模式
首页
上一页
...
6
7
8
9
10
...
下一页
尾页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他